Ladywell Station is bustling with activity, providing facilities aimed at making your experience as seamless as possible. You’ll find ticket machines located on the station forecourt, with accessible machines to ease your travel preparations. Whether you're collecting tickets bought online or validate your smartcards, the station ensures an effortless start to your journey. However, do note that the ticket office is only open from 06:10 till 19:30 on weekdays and shorter hours on Saturdays.
While the station does not feature toilets or waiting rooms, it remains user-friendly for those with accessibility needs. Step-free access is available to some platforms via ramps, making it friendlier for those with disabilities. For your comfort, there’s a seating area on-site. And if you're a cyclist, there are eight sheltered bicycle stands located at Platform 1, providing a secure space to leave your bike while you travel.
Making your way around London is seamless from Ladywell Station. For those needing a rail replacement service, buses towards Lewisham and Hayes are readily available just off Ladywell Road. Aylesford Station, despite its compact nature, makes ticketing a breeze for travelers. While there is no staffed ticket office, the station offers accessible ticket machines on platform 1, enabling you to collect tickets purchased online with ease. This feature can be especially convenient for travelers who plan their journeys in advance. Additionally, the station is equipped with induction loops, essential for those with hearing impairments.
Accessibility, however, is a mixed bag at Aylesford Station. While platform 1 is accessible step-free for trains headed towards Strood, platform 2, unfortunately, lacks similar access. There is a footbridge for crossover, making it less suitable for those with mobility impairments. On the upside, there is a wheelchair ramp available on the trains themselves, highlighting an effort to facilitate easier boarding and alighting for passengers requiring assistance.
